OverviewThis book provides comprehensive information regarding the concept of regenerative medicine. Regenerative drug is a form of medicine used for recreating human cells or organs to restore ordinary functions. This field of medicine holds the assurance of regenerating injured organs in the body by replacing blemished tissue and by stimulating the body's own restore means to heal previously permanent tissues or organs. The historic origins of this medical discipline have even been evidenced in many cultures including Greek mythology. This book comprises of several aspects of regenerative medicine and even analyzes its advancements and its diverse functions.
